THERE’s still time to register to attend the Echo-backed Business Works.
The event, in association with Trethowans Solicitors, returns to the four-star Novotel Hotel, in the heart of Southampton on February 10, and is free to attend.
Everyone who registers to attend is within a chance of winning one of 50 pairs of tickets to see An Inspector Calls at Southampton’s Mayflower Theatre in April.
